How to read plastic labeling and symbols

Reading labels is your first line of defense. The microwave safe symbol, when present, is often a small rectangle with wavy lines or a microwave icon. Some containers say microwave safe without a symbol; others rely on a recycling code to indicate material type rather than safety. The common plastics used for food storage include polypropylene (PP), polyethylene (PE), and PET; among these, PP is frequently recommended for microwave use, while older polycarbonate containers may contain additives such as BPA. BPA-free does not automatically guarantee microwave safety; always corroborate with explicit microwave safe labeling. If a container shows cracks, discoloration, or warping, retire it. And remember to leave space for steam when heating, and to vent lids to prevent pressure buildup. Microwave Answers highlights that regional labeling varies, so check both symbols and written instructions. For home cooks, a quick rule is to treat any plastic without a clear microwave safe label as a potential risk and opt for glass when possible.

Practical tips for safe microwave use with plastics

  • Use only containers clearly labeled microwave safe and appropriate for heating. If there is any doubt, transfer to glass or ceramic.
  • Do not heat single use or damaged plastics, bags, or wraps. These materials can warp, melt, or shed additives into food.
  • Remove or vent the lid, cover with a microwave safe plate, and use a venting lid or microwave-safe silicone cover to minimize splatter.
  • When reheating fatty or acidic foods, be particularly cautious because uneven heating can drive higher temperatures at the container surface.
  • Let containers stand for a minute after microwaving to allow heat to distribute; this reduces hot spots and potential degradation.
  • After cooling, inspect for cracks or clouding, and replace as needed.
  • For best results, use glass or ceramic for temperatures above moderate heat. Silicone lids are safe for some containers, but ensure they are food-safe and labeled for microwave use.
  • Always wash containers by hand when possible to preserve coatings and labels; avoid harsh scrubbing that can wear away the safety markings.

What to do if you're unsure

Start by looking for the microwave safe symbol or explicit instructions. If the container lacks clear guidance, transfer your food to glass or ceramic before heating. A cautious home test is to place a small amount of water in the container and microwave briefly; if the container becomes very hot to touch, it should not be used for heating. If the container remains cool and the water heats, it is more likely safe for warming. However, always err on the side of caution and substitute with a known microwave safe option. Common myths and misunderstandings

A frequent myth is that BPA-free automatically means microwave safe. Not necessarily. BPA-free reduces exposure to that chemical, but other additives can migrate under heat. Another misconception is that all plastics are safe for microwaving if they are labeled dishwasher-safe. The two properties are independent; a container may be dishwasher-safe but not microwave-safe. Finally, some people assume that if a container looks sturdy it is safe for high heat. Visual integrity is not a substitute for labeling and testing. Always prioritize containers explicitly marked microwave safe and, when in doubt, switch to glass or ceramic.
